What to check before renting from contacts with high-rise buildings in Brooklyn
- Check tenant ratings to gauge landlord reliability.
- Review eviction records to understand potential issues with management.
- Examine litigation history for insights into previous tenant disputes.
- Compare different high-rise buildings based on amenities and location.
- Research property managers to see if they manage multiple buildings in the area.
